This assignment is more than a book report and much more than a summary of the book. Although you will include a brief summary, your book review should be a critical analysis of the book.
Use the questions below to help you think of how to look at the book and use the handout on the second page as a guide to how your review should be organized. Use your own words.
Identify the author’s content and purpose.
Did the author fulfill her purpose in the book?
Did she use credible and unbiased evidence to support her argument?
Was the book engaging?
Did you agree with the author?
Did you enjoy it?
Would you recommend it to others?
Who is the intended audience, and would this audience find the book helpful? Would they enjoy it?
